Arrival at the Missionary Training Center
We arrived at the MTC on Monday morning along with 100 or so other senior missionaries. Most were assigned to either the "Member and Leader Support" or "Military Relations" categories. Just five of us missionary couples are assigned as "Young Single Adult" missionaries, and the five of us YSA couples were put together in the same MTC district. Also in our district is Elder and Sister Denison, who will be serving with us in Rome as YSA missionaries. Their assignment is to Palermo for four months then they will transfer to Napoli to be the first YSA couple there.
During the lunch break with all the missionaries here at the MTC, we found a group of young Elders and Sisters going to Rome with us. What a delight to meet them. We look forward to serving along side them!

We received our mission call on May 17, to the Italy Rome Mission as stake Young Single Adult specialists! We were both hoping to be called to Italy as that is where I served as a young man, but after corresponding with the incoming president to the Italy Milan Mission, we were quite sure we would be called to Milan and very pleasantly surprised to get the call to Rome instead. Several weeks ago, we were able to visit with President Morris and he assigned us to work in the Puglia Stake where we will be living in Bari. We're thrilled with the assignment and can hardly believe that we're only a few weeks away from starting. We begin two weeks at the Provo Missionary Training Center on January 16, then fly to Italy on January 31.
